Abstract

The invention discloses a k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material and preparation method thereof, spacecraft luggage boxboard is made up of with environment-friendly polyurethane expanded material following quality proportioning component, isocyanates:Combination material=1:1.8, the composition of the combination material is based on following mass fraction:Polyethers 835:35 45 parts, polyethers 10200:20 25 parts, polyethers 10300:35 40 parts, polyethers 8310:35 40 parts, silicone oil:2.5 3.0 parts, catalyst HP17:1.5 1.8 parts, catalyst HP50:1.5 1.8 parts, water:3.0 3.3 parts, fire retardant TCPP:35 40 parts.After above-mentioned material and method, so that the environment-friendly polyurethane expanded material fire resistance prepared is high, high temperature, chance fire are nonflammable, in addition, the spacecraft luggage case being made, weight is very light, can adapt to the weight demands of aircraft, because the use raw material of expanded material is environmentally friendly raw material, thus it will not discharge to the poisonous and hazardous material of human body.

A k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material and preparation method thereof
Technical field
The present invention relates to a k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material and preparation method thereof.
Background technology
At present, with the development of spacecraft, luggage case is as the important component of spacecraft particularly manned spacecraft, and it is prevented Fire safety is to be vital, and existing spacecraft baggage compartment capacity also constantly expands, and luggage box timber is pacified except fire prevention Beyond full property, in addition it is also necessary to lightweight, high intensity, high density, the speciality of high in environmental protection, with adapt to spacecraft overall weight and The requirement of luggage is stored, in order to reach this purpose, various materials have been attempted as the material of spacecraft luggage boxboard.But Pursuing light-weighted while also causing security reduction, spacecraft does not allow accident occur, it is necessary to reach high-quality requirement.Cause How this had not only met light-weighted demand but also had ensured that security is an insoluble technical problem with fire resistance.
The content of the invention
The technical problems to be solved by the invention are that the defect for overcoming prior art is used there is provided a kind of spacecraft luggage boxboard Environment-friendly polyurethane expanded material, its fire resistance is high, lightweight and environmental protection.
In order to solve the above-mentioned technical problem, the technical scheme is that:A kind of spacecraft luggage boxboard is with environmentally friendly poly- ammonia Ester foaming material, is made up of, isocyanates following quality proportioning component:Combination material=1:Combined described in 1.8 the composition of material by with Lower mass fraction meter, specific mass fraction is as follows:
Polyethers 835:35-45 parts;
Polyethers 10200:20-25 parts;
Polyethers 10300:35-40 parts;
Polyethers 8310:35-40 parts;
Silicone oil:2.5-3.0 part;
Catalyst HP17:1.5-1.8 part;
Catalyst HP50:1.5-1.8 part;
Water:3.0-3.3 part;
Fire retardant TCPP:35-40 parts.
Further, the silicone oil can be silicone oil AK-8804.
Present invention also offers a kind of preparation method of spacecraft luggage boxboard environment-friendly polyurethane expanded material material, including Following preparation process:Combination material is prepared first:By polyethers 835, polyethers 10200, polyethers 10300, polyethers 8310, silicone oil, catalysis Agent HP17, catalyst HP50, fire retardant TCPP and water add in reactor and carry out hybrid reaction, mixing speed 130-150r/ Min, mixing time 4-5h can must combine material, then again by isocyanates with combining material by 1:1.8 mass ratio is well mixed, It can be prepared by the expanded material.
After above technical scheme, because recipe ingredient collocation is reasonable and preparation method is proper so that the hair of preparation Foam material fire resistance is high, so that fire savety and the personal safety of spacecraft high-speed cruising have been ensured, in addition, the row being made Lee's case, weight is very light, can adapt to the weight demands of spacecraft, because the use raw material of expanded material is environmentally friendly raw material, It will not thus discharge to the poisonous and hazardous material of human body.
Embodiment
In order that present disclosure is easier to be clearly understood, below according to specific embodiment, the present invention is made into One step is described in detail.
Embodiment one:
A k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material, including following preparation process:First with mass parts Number meter, prepares combination material:
Polyethers 835:35 parts;
Polyethers 10200:20 parts;
Polyethers 10300:35 parts;
Polyethers 8310:35 parts;
Silicone oil:2.5 part;
Catalyst HP17:1.5 part;
Catalyst HP50:1.5 part;
Water:3.0 part;
Fire retardant TCPP:35 parts.
Above material is added in reactor and carries out hybrid reaction, mixing speed 130r/min, mixing time 5h can be obtained Combination material, then again by isocyanates with combining material by 1:1.8 mass ratio is well mixed, you can the expanded material is made.
Wherein, the silicone oil can be silicone oil AK-8804.
Embodiment two:
A k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material, including following preparation process:First with mass parts Number meter, prepares combination material:
Polyethers 835:40 parts;
Polyethers 10200:22.5 parts;
Polyethers 10300:37.5 parts;
Polyethers 8310:37.5 parts;
Silicone oil:2.75 part;
Catalyst HP17:1.65 part;
Catalyst HP50:1.65 part;
Water:3.15 part;
Fire retardant TCPP:37.5 parts.
Above material is added in reactor and carries out hybrid reaction, mixing speed 140r/min, mixing time 4.5h Material must be combined, then again by isocyanates with combining material by 1:1.8 mass ratio is well mixed, you can the foaming material is made Material.
Wherein, the silicone oil can be silicone oil AK-8804.
Embodiment three:
A kind of spacecraft luggage boxboard environment-friendly polyurethane expanded material, including following preparation process:First with mass parts Number meter, prepares combination material:
Polyethers 835:45 parts;
Polyethers 10200:25 parts;
Polyethers 10300:40 parts;
Polyethers 8310:40 parts;
Silicone oil:3 parts;
Catalyst HP17:1.8 part;
Catalyst HP50:1.8 part;
Water:3.3 part;
Fire retardant TCPP:40 parts.
Above material is added in reactor and carries out hybrid reaction, mixing speed 150r/min, mixing time 4h can be obtained Combination material, then again by isocyanates with combining material by 1:1.8 mass ratio is well mixed, you can the expanded material is made.
Wherein, the silicone oil can be silicone oil AK-8804.
The fire resistance for a kind of environmentally friendly high flame-retardant polyurethane expanded material of spacecraft luggage boxboard of the invention is surveyed below Test result:
Test stone requirement:The burning velocity of fire proofing should be not more than 100mm/min, distinguish if there are following situations Result of the test is identified on request, and assay is divided into 5 grades of A, B, C, D, E:
A:(0mm/min):Sample is exposed to 15S in flame, and extinguishing burning things which may cause a fire disaster sample is still unburned, or sample can burn, but Flame reaches extinguishing before the first measurement graticule, and no burning extent can be counted.
B:When tester, flame self-extinguish in 60s, and burning extent is not more than 50mm, then it is assumed that meet Standard requirement.
C:Burning velocity measured value (mm/min)
When tester, flame extinguishes between two measurement graticules, and when being unsatisfactory for the 2nd article of situation, then by mark Standard calculates burning velocity.
D:Burning velocity measured value (mm/min)
When tester, flame combustion reaches the second graticule, or since timing, sample long-time smoulder, Then can in tester termination test during 20min, and record burning time and burning extent and by criterion calculation burning velocity.
E:Sample has burnt in flame ignition 15s and has reached the first graticule, then it is assumed that sample can not meet burning speed The requirement of degree.
Assay:A-B (0mm/min), is gathered using spacecraft luggage boxboard manufactured in the present embodiment with environmentally friendly high fire-retardance Urethane expanded material meets fire resistance requirement.
